Psalms
A collection of songs and prayers expressing a wide range of emotions and thoughts on faith.
Chapter 48
Back to Chapters
1
Great is the LORD, and greatly to be praised in the city of our God, in the mountain of his holiness.
*God is great and deserves lots of praise in the special city where he lives, on a holy mountain.
2
Beautiful for situation, the joy of the whole earth, is mount Zion, on the sides of the north, the city of the great King.
*Mount Zion, a lovely place, brings happiness to all Earth, is located in the north's side and is the city of a mighty King.
3
God is known in her palaces for a refuge.
*God is recognized in her grand buildings as a safe place.
4
For, lo, the kings were assembled, they passed by together.
*Behold, the kings came together, they went past all at once.
5
They saw it, and so they marvelled; they were troubled, and hasted away.
*They saw it and were amazed. They were worried and quickly left.
6
Fear took hold upon them there, and pain, as of a woman in travail.
*Fear and pain gripped them strongly, like the pain of a woman giving birth.
7
Thou breakest the ships of Tarshish with an east wind.
*You shatter the ships of Tarshish with an east wind.
8
As we have heard, so have we seen in the city of the LORD of hosts, in the city of our God: God will establish it for ever. Selah.
*Just like we heard, we have also witnessed this in the city of God's powerful army - the place where He resides. There, God will make it last forever. Pause and reflect.
9
We have thought of thy lovingkindness, O God, in the midst of thy temple.
*We remember your kindness, God, while in your special place.
10
According to thy name, O God, so is thy praise unto the ends of the earth: thy right hand is full of righteousness.
*As your name says, God, your praise goes everywhere: your right hand shows you are fair and just.
11
Let mount Zion rejoice, let the daughters of Judah be glad, because of thy judgments.
*Rejoice, Mount Zion! Daughters of Judah, be happy! This is because of God's fair decisions.
12
Walk about Zion, and go round about her: tell the towers thereof.
*Walk around Zion and look at its towers; describe them.
13
Mark ye well her bulwarks, consider her palaces; that ye may tell it to the generation following.
*Observe her defenses carefully, look at her grand buildings; so you can pass this information on to future generations.
14
For this God is our God for ever and ever: he will be our guide even unto death.
*This God is always with us forever; He'll guide us until we pass away.
